Product description

Product Description

The 5D, 7D, 10D, 14D and 20D metal oxide varistors (MOVs) protect electrical and electronic equipment against lightning surges, switching surges and other transient overvoltages.

When the applied voltage remains below the varistor threshold, only a very small leakage current passes through the component. When the voltage exceeds the threshold, the varistor’s resistance decreases rapidly, allowing it to absorb and divert surge energy to protect downstream circuits.

Product Types

Surge Suppression Type

Designed to suppress random, non-periodic transient overvoltages caused by lightning strikes, switching operations and similar events. These surges may produce very high peak voltage and current.

High-Power Type

Designed to absorb repetitive pulse groups, such as periodic switching spikes generated by switch-mode power converters. Although each voltage peak may be moderate, the high repetition rate can produce substantial average power.

High-Energy Type

Designed to absorb magnetic energy released by large inductive loads, including generator excitation coils, lifting electromagnets and other high-inductance coils. Energy-absorption capability is the primary selection factor.

Working Principle

When the applied voltage is lower than the varistor voltage, the current flowing through the MOV is extremely small and the device behaves like a high-resistance component.

When the applied voltage exceeds the varistor threshold, the current increases rapidly and the resistance drops sharply. The MOV then diverts the surge current and clamps the voltage to a safer level.

Electrical Parameter Definitions

ParameterDescription
Varistor Voltage V1mAVoltage measured when a DC current of 1 mA passes through the varistor
Maximum Allowable AC VoltageMaximum continuous RMS AC operating voltage
Maximum Allowable DC VoltageMaximum continuous DC operating voltage
Clamping Voltage VcMaximum voltage across the varistor at the specified 8/20 μs impulse current
Test Current IpImpulse current used to measure clamping voltage
Energy RatingMaximum absorbable energy under 10/1000 μs or 2 ms pulse conditions
Surge CurrentMaximum current capacity under an 8/20 μs impulse
Rated PowerMaximum continuous power dissipation
CapacitanceReference capacitance measured at 1 kHz

Series Dimensions

SeriesMaximum Disc DiameterMaximum HeightMinimum Lead LengthLead SpacingLead Diameter
5D7.5 mm9.5 mm25 mm5 ±1 mm0.6 ±0.02 mm
7D9 mm11 mm25 mm5 ±1 mm0.6 ±0.02 mm
10D13 mm15 mm25 mm7.5 ±1 mm0.8 ±0.02 mm
14D17 mm19 mm25 mm7.5 ±1 mm0.8 ±0.02 mm
20D23 mm25 mm25 mm10 ±1 mm1.0 ±0.02 mm
